Bukayo Saka scores two goals as England leads France in World Cup match
Yahoo Sports • 1 min read • Latest: Jul 18, 2026, 10:12 PM
Last updated Jul 18, 2026
Bukayo Saka scored twice for England in their World Cup third-place match against France on July 18 in Miami Gardens. England took a commanding 4-0 lead by halftime, with Saka netting his third goal in the 37th minute and another at the start of the second half. The match highlights England's strong performance after progressing through the knockout stages of the tournament, including victories over Mexico and Argentina. The game remains ongoing as England seeks to secure their position with a substantial advantage.
